Effort Over Results
Effort Over Results (EOR) aims to bring quality interviews with guests from all walks of life. From business leaders to health and wellness professionals, EOR provides content that is relevant and important to those who want to develop resilience, improve performance and practice self-care through a ”Growth Mindset” and focused effort.

Host Quinn Magnuson and Jim Brayshaw, a 30 year Fire Dept veteran and Captain explore the critical themes surrounding workplace safety, trust among colleagues, and the emotional needs of employees. Jim delves into the importance of feeling safe at work, the role of supervisors in fostering trust, and the impact of unmet emotional needs on employee well-being. A critical discussion on how workplaces need to shift to a fully psychologically safe workplace and to embrace a growth mindset around employee development

In this engaging conversation, Jon Ryan shares his remarkable journey from a young boy in Regina, Saskatchewan, to becoming a celebrated punter in the NFL. He reflects on pivotal moments in his career, including the unforgettable NFC Championship game, the challenges of personal loss, and the importance of effort over results. Jon discusses the camaraderie within the Seattle Seahawks during their Super Bowl runs, his return to Saskatchewan to play for the Roughriders, and his transition into baseball ownership. He also highlights the inspiration behind his new podcast, 'The Book Lisp,' and offers valuable advice for young athletes about the significance of consistency and passion in achieving their goals.

In this conversation, Quinn Magnuson and Adrianne Van Gool explore the themes of personal growth, the importance of effort over results, and the integration of yoga and therapy in personal and professional settings. Adrianne shares her journey from athletics to physiotherapy and yoga, emphasizing the significance of a growth mindset and self-care in leadership and wellness. The discussion highlights the evolving perception of yoga in modern culture and its relevance in corporate environments, particularly in fostering empathy and understanding among leaders.
